Factors to Consider When Choosing Knives Under 200

When shopping for knives under 200, it’s important to consider several factors that influence both performance and longevity. Understanding these can help avoid common pitfalls like choosing a blade that’s too soft or handles that lack comfort. The right knife should feel balanced, stay sharp through multiple uses, and suit your specific cooking habits. Keep in mind that investing a little more in certain features can significantly improve your experience and satisfaction over time.

Blade Material and Edge Retention

Look for knives made from high-quality stainless steel or Damascus steel, which tend to hold an edge longer and resist corrosion. Cheaper steels may require frequent sharpening and can dull quickly, reducing efficiency in the kitchen. Consider whether the blade is easy to sharpen at home or if you’ll need professional help. Balance durability with ease of maintenance to find a model that fits your skill level and routine.

Handle Comfort and Ergonomics

An ergonomic handle reduces fatigue during extended use and improves control. Materials like pakkawood, textured plastic, or stainless steel with rubber inserts can enhance grip and comfort. Avoid handles that feel bulky or slippery, especially if you often work with wet hands. A comfortable handle is vital for safety and precision, making it worth paying attention to even in budget-friendly options.

Knife Balance and Weight

A well-balanced knife feels natural in your hand, reducing strain and improving cutting accuracy. Heavier knives are often more stable for chopping, but may be tiring over time, while lighter blades allow for more finesse but may lack heft for tougher tasks. Testing the weight distribution and handle feel can help determine what suits your style and strength best.

Set vs. Individual Knives

Buying a set can offer great value and versatility, providing essential blades for different tasks. However, individual knives tailored to specific needs—like a dedicated meat cleaver or paring knife—can outperform generic options. Consider your typical cooking routines and whether a set covers your needs or if investing in specialty knives makes more sense, even if it means some compromise in budget.

Maintenance and Ease of Sharpening

Choose knives that are easy to sharpen at home if you prefer to maintain your blades yourself. Many budget-friendly knives are compatible with common sharpening tools, but some specialized steels may require professional services. Regular honing and proper storage can extend your knife’s lifespan significantly, so factor in how much effort you’re willing to put into upkeep when selecting your model.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I find a high-quality knife under 200 that will last for years?

Yes, many knives in this price range use durable stainless steel or Damascus steel, which can last for years with proper care. Maintaining a regular sharpening schedule and avoiding misuse can extend the life of your blade. While they may not match premium professional knives, well-chosen models under 200 can deliver long-lasting performance for everyday cooking.

Is a set of knives better than a single high-quality piece?

Sets often provide better overall value and cover a variety of kitchen tasks, making them a practical choice for most home cooks. However, a single high-quality knife tailored to your specific needs—like a chef’s knife—can outperform a set in terms of sharpness and comfort. Consider your cooking style and whether you prefer versatility or specialized performance when choosing between sets and individual knives.

What handle material offers the best grip in wet conditions?

Handles made from textured plastic, rubberized grips, or pakkawood tend to provide the best grip when wet. Avoid smooth or slippery materials that can compromise control and safety. A comfortable, secure grip is especially important if you cook frequently or work with moist ingredients, making handle choice a key factor in your selection process.

Should I prioritize set variety or a single premium knife?

This depends on your cooking habits. If you prepare a wide range of dishes regularly, a versatile set offers convenience and value. Conversely, if you focus on specific tasks like slicing or precision work, investing in a single, high-quality knife might deliver better results and satisfaction. Balance your needs against your budget to make the best choice.

Are expensive-looking knives necessarily better?

Not always. Appearance can be deceiving; some budget knives mimic the look of premium blades but lack the same edge retention or durability. Focus on the steel quality, handle ergonomics, and reviews rather than just aesthetics. A well-made, modestly priced knife can outperform a flashy but inferior-looking counterpart over time.
